An 8-core fiber optic cable contains eight individual optical fibers bundled within a protective sheath, allowing multiple data channels to operate simultaneously. These cables are ideal for medium-scale network infrastructure, such as building backbones, interconnecting server rooms, or expanding metropolitan area networks, and can transmit data at speeds from 1 Gbps up to 100 Gbps depending on the transceiver and fiber type (single-mode for long distances, multimode for shorter runs) . The physical structure typically includes color-coded fibers, strength members like aramid yarn, and jackets rated for indoor, outdoor, or riser/plenum environments .
For IoT deployments, hybrid cables combine optical fibers with copper conductors in a single unit, enabling simultaneous data and power delivery to remote devices such as sensors, small cells, or distributed antenna systems (DAS) . These cables reduce installation complexity, save space, and lower total cost of ownership by consolidating multiple functions into one cable. They are designed for both indoor and outdoor use, often featuring corrugated armor or high-performance polymer jackets compliant with standards like IEC 60332 and UL 1277 .
For high-density IoT or data center environments, MPO/MTP 8-core patch cords provide compact, high-performance connections. These cables support multimode OM3/OM4 fibers and allow easy field configuration with fan-out LC connectors, making them suitable for environments with limited space while maintaining high bandwidth and reliability . The push-pull release mechanism simplifies installation and reduces the risk of connector damage .
